%A SUN Dui-xiong;SU Mao-gen;DONG Chen-zhong;MA Yun-yun;YANG Feng;CAO Shi-quan %T Spectroscopic Study of Laser Induced Breakdown Plasma Spectroscopy in Air and Semi-Empirical Simulation %0 Journal Article %D 2014 %J SPECTROSCOPY AND SPECTRAL ANALYSIS %R 10.3964/j.issn.1000-0593(2014)12-3230-05 %P 3230-3234 %V 34 %N 12 %U {https://www.gpxygpfx.com/CN/abstract/article_7379.shtml} %8 2014-12-01 %X A laser induced breakdown spectroscopy experiment was carried out using Nd∶YAG laser in air, and time-resolved spectra were measured. Based on local thermodynamic equilibrium assumption, a method used to simulate LIBS spectra is proposed. A LIBS spectrum of air in the wavelength range of 700~900 nm was simulated using this method. A good agreement between experiment and simulation was obtained, and moreover, the relative concentrations of the N, O and Ar in air were obtained.
